Singapore, Singapore Feb 23, 2026 (Issuewire.com) - Uninova International Bank, a licensed international financial institution, has reaffirmed its strategic commitment to supporting international commerce through structured banking solutions tailored for cross-border transactions and global trade operations.
In response to increasing demand for specialized trade finance mechanisms, the bank has expanded its capabilities in bank guarantees (BG), standby letters of credit (SBLC), and structured financial arrangements designed to facilitate secure and efficient international transactions. These services are positioned to support corporate clients, project developers, and professional intermediaries engaged in global commercial activities.
The institution’s structured banking framework emphasizes disciplined operational standards, internal compliance procedures, and carefully managed transaction protocols. By aligning its services with evolving international trade requirements, Uninova International Bank aims to provide reliable financial infrastructure that supports sustainable business growth across jurisdictions.
“Our focus is to provide structured, transparent, and professionally managed financial solutions that support legitimate international trade,” said a senior representative of Uninova International Bank. “As global commerce becomes more interconnected and complex, the need for disciplined trade finance and secure cross-border banking solutions continues to grow. We are committed to meeting that demand with institutional rigor and strategic partnerships.”
In addition to its trade finance services, the bank continues to enhance its secure digital banking platform, enabling clients to manage accounts and monitor transactions remotely through a protected online environment. This digital capability supports the increasing need for efficiency and operational oversight in international business activities.
Uninova International Bank stated that it will continue strengthening correspondent relationships and expanding its intermediary network as part of its long-term institutional development strategy.
